Capgemini is a global leader in partnering with companies to transform and manage their business by harnessing the power of technology. The Group is guided everyday by its purpose of unleashing human energy through technology for an inclusive and sustainable future. It is a responsible and diverse organization of 350,000 team members in more than 50 countries. With its strong 55-year heritage and deep industry expertise, Capgemini is trusted by its clients to address the entire breadth of their business needs, from strategy and design to operations, fueled by the fast evolving and innovative world of cloud, data, AI, connectivity, software, digital engineering and platforms. The Group reported in 2022 global revenues of €22 billion.

S/4HANA 1610 Release

November 29, 2016 07:26 - 2 minutes - 2.33 MB

Ryan Briggs Capgemini Application Consultant talks about the new 1610 S/4HANA release which includes a range of additional and new content. These include: New best practises specifically to GB, such as configuration for GB content like pricing conditions. Standard config for Asset Management. Test scripts and master data to support them.
